Recommendation
The Government should set out in the renewed Women’s Health Strategy a rigorous approach to tackling the risks from ineffective, unsafe and exploitative for-profit FemTech apps. To combat demand for these apps the Government must increase resourcing of the NHS’s Innovation, Research and Life Sciences team, to drive forward NHS provision of digital tools. The strategy should set out clear priorities for the development of women’s digital health functionality, which we believe should include accurate and effective period trackers, grounded in diverse data, and accessible to girls and women via the NHS app. The strategy should set out a timeline to implementation of this functionality.
